Located in idyllic surroundings, the JURASSICA Museum traces the natural heritage of the Jura region.
Its rich and varied collections include numerous marine fossils. The exhibition “Faune et flora locales” (local fauna and flora) is dedicated to the appreciation of biodiversity past and present and features, among other things, amazing displays of stuffed animals. A first-rate collection of minerals completes the offering. The JURASSICA Museum’s policy also includes special and temporary exhibitions, covering one or two novel themes every year.
Guided tours of the museum can be booked on request, as can tours of the various Jurassica ‘satellite’ sites, including the botanical garden, the Banné excavation site and Dinotec. Tours can be accompanied by an aperitif.
